Fig. 4

Tg(wnt8aPAC:EGFP) expression depends on Nodal. A–J: In situ hybridizations in control (A,C,E,G,I) or SB-431542 treated embryos (B,D,F,H,J). A–F: Shield stage, animal pole views, dorsal right. A,B: wnt8a levels in the ventrolateral margin are reduced when Nodal signaling is inhibited, and the dorsal clearing is expanded (arrows). C,D: Tg(wnt8aPAC:EGFP) expression responds in an identical way to wnt8a. E,F: In situ hybridization for ntl to confirm effectiveness of SB-431542 treatment. Note dorsal clearing of ntl (arrows), corresponding to the loss of dorsal mesoderm; this phenotype resembles the cyc;sqt double mutant (compare to fig. 6U in Dougan et al., 2003). G–J: Late bud stage, posterior views. G,H: wnt8a expression persists in the tailbud of SB-431542-treated embryos but is not detected in the prospective pronephros. Arrows indicate prospective pronephros expression domain. I,J: Tg(wnt8aPAC:EGFP) expression responds identically to wnt8a. Persistent transcripts are observed in the tail paraxial mesoderm (asterisks). Note that no EGFP transcripts are detected in the position of the prospective pronephros, lateral to the presomitic mesoderm domain (arrow). K–P: The EGFP+ lineage forms tail mesoderm in SB-431542-treated embryos. K,L: Control Tg(wnt8aPAC:EGFP) 24-hpf embryo. Note strong expression in trunk and tail mesoderm. M,N: 24-hpf SB-431542-treated Tg(wnt8aPAC:EGFP) embryos. Note that developing tail mesoderm expresses EGFP. O: EGFP transcripts in a control Tg(wnt8aPAC:EGFP) embryo. Note expression in tailbud (arrow) but not in trunk or tail somitic mesoderm. P: EGFP transcripts are also detected in the tailbud of SB-431542-treated Tg(wnt8aPAC:EGFP) embryos (arrow).
